The brief

This contract provides DVLA with the use of fuel cards to pay for the fuel and related services while driving for official business.

It covers the provision of fuel card services to support the operational requirements of the contracting authority's vehicle fleet.

This contract was awarded following a mini-competition under Crown Commercial Services Fuel Cards and Associated Services VI Framework agreement RM6186.

The contract will be for a 2-year period which will run from 5th December 2025 to 4th December 2027.

The advertised maximum contract value includes Fuel Costs.
